About the piece
Painted in 1892, this expressive oil on panel by Belgian artist Henri Evenepoel depicts the artist's grandfather in a moment of rest. The work is characterized by its heavy impasto and a muted, tonal palette of ochres, greys, and browns, showcasing the artist's confident technique and ability to capture intimate, human moments.
